No Companion Cert with CIBC Aerogold

I recently had my annual fee show up on my statement, and so I thought I'd go back and review the Ts & Cs to see if anything had changed. I don't use Aerogold much anymore as a result of Amex giving 1.5 points per $ and the SPG Mastercard giving a good return for non-Amex charges with no annual fee.

To my surprise, I found that Aerogold no longer offers the free AC Companion Ticket, and this was confirmed by an agent when I called. While many have commented in previous threads about the limited value of these certs, I have managed to use them each year and they have provided some value. The cancellation of these certs is a further devaluation in the increasingly slim usefulness to me of the Aerogold card, which I'm now cancelling. Note you have to cancel within 2 months of the date of your renewal in order to get a prorated refund on your annual fees.

The AC companion ticket voucher ("CTV") that CIBC sent out in March 2004 to all its Aerogold cardholders was a one time special offer. When CIBC first introduced the Aerogold optional Travel Club during the latter part of 2004, the CTV was to be a regular offer. It was discontinued in early 2005 because CIBC "listened" to its customers, and most of them did not want it. Therefore, the membership fee was reduced by $10 plus 500 AP points for renewing in lieu of the CTV and there was what "you", the cardholders have wanted, according to CIBC! The CTV is of limited good if you normally purchase the cheapest fare. If you travel with a pal in J or C, the CTV is excellent value. I think CIBC is trying to convert its Aerogold cardholders to its new Adventura Visa.
